Extra Extra

  • Former Sun-Times TV critic Paige Wiser dusts herself off from her firing, starts new career as a "philosopher." [Planet Paige, via Zorn]
  • A woman was hit by a piece of aluminum that fell from Joffrey Tower (151 N. State St.) yesterday. [Chicago Breaking News]
  • CBOE announced it will buy back up to $100 million in stock. [Crain's]
  • Gov. Quinn signed "Zach's Law," aimed at preventing movable soccer goals from tipping over and causing death or injury. [Sun-Times]
  • Seven cases of salmonella in Illinois have been linked to ground turkey. [Daily Herald]
  • The Field Museum's toilets have been named among the best in the country. [WGN TV]
  • How Illinois lawmakers voted on the debt bill. [ABC 7]
  • The Bears and Desmond Clark agree to a one-year deal. [ESPN Chicago]
